What is Renaissance Learning?

Renaissance Learning is an educational technology company that provides assessment and practice solutions for K-12 schools. Their products, such as Accelerated Reader, Star Assessments, and Freckle, are designed to support personalized learning and improve student outcomes. Educators use Renaissance Learning's tools to track student progress, inform instruction, and help students achieve academic growth. The company serves schools worldwide and is known for its data-driven approach to education.

What are the typical responsibilities and collaborative dynamics for a software engineer at Renaissance Learning?

As a Software Engineer at Renaissance Learning, you can expect to work on developing and maintaining educational technology products, often as part of an agile, cross-functional team. Daily tasks include coding, code reviews, and participating in sprint planning and retrospectives. Collaboration is a key part of the role, as you'll regularly interact with product managers, UX designers, QA testers, and other engineers to deliver high-quality software solutions. Adapting to evolving requirements and ensuring scalability and accessibility in educational tools are common challenges faced in this environment.

What We Look For In a AP European History Tutor
  • Advanced Subject Mastery: Deep knowledge of European history from the Renaissance through the present, including the Reformation, Scientific Revolution, Enlightenment, French Revolution, industrialization, imperialism, World Wars, Cold War, and European integration. Ability to explain political, economic, social, and cultural developments while preparing students for the AP European History examination.
  • Conceptual Teaching & Problem-Solving: Skilled at teaching primary source analysis, document-based question construction, and long essay argument development for AP European History. Guides students through evaluating historical causation, analyzing continuity and change over time, making cross-period comparisons, and constructing evidence-based historical arguments. Emphasizes developing historiographical awareness and connecting European developments to global contexts.
  • Curriculum Awareness & Adaptive Instruction: Familiar with AP European History curriculum across nine periods and common challenges such as managing the breadth of content, writing thesis-driven DBQ responses, and analyzing visual primary sources. Adapts instruction using primary source workshops, timeline construction, and AP-style essay practice to support students developing historical thinking skills for the examination and college history coursework.
